To adjust the voice volume, press the Volume key up or
down.
To activate the speakerphone feature, select
In noisy environments, you may have difficulty
hearing some calls while using the speakerphone
feature. For better audio performance, use the
normal phone mode.
To turn off the microphone so that the other party
cannot hear you, select Mute.
To listen and talk to the other party via the Bluetooth
headset, select Headset.

To make a multiparty call (conference call), make or
answer a second call and select Merge when connected
to the second party. Repeat to add more parties. You
must subscribe to the multiparty call service to use this
feature.

View and dial missed calls

Your device will display calls you have missed on the
display. To dial the number of a missed call, open the
shortcut panel and select the missed call.
